Working much less however paying out extra
Over the previous 150 years, the typical variety of working hours per week has dropped. Within the late nineteenth century, individuals labored over 60 hours per week, however at present, the typical is way decrease, particularly in developed nations.
Though we’re working fewer hours, many individuals nonetheless wrestle to satisfy fundamental wants resulting from regional price variations and different hidden bills. In line with the Joseph Rowntree Basis, a single particular person wants a minimum of £29,500 yearly to attain a good lifestyle, whereas a pair with two youngsters wants round £50,000.
Your job is costing you extra
- Utilizing the mistaken job title on insurance coverage: Mislabeling your job could make you pay increased premiums. As an example, a “quick meals supply driver” would possibly pay £200 extra yearly than a “courier” resulting from threat variations.
- Excessive commuting prices: Gas, practice tickets, or bus fares can drain your funds. Commuting by practice in London can price a mean of £592.40 per 30 days. Over a yr, that’s over £7,000 simply to get to work! Even in Leeds, the place it’s cheaper, you’ll be paying out over £2,000 a yr.
- Shopping for your individual stationery: Academics and different professionals usually spend their very own cash on provides. These prices can add as much as £1,000 yearly, consuming into your wage.
- Office social prices: Contributing to espresso funds, birthday items, and Christmas events might sound small, however they will quietly drain your checking account by a number of hundred over the yr. These workplace whip-rounds add up!
- Pointless memberships: Membership charges for skilled our bodies can price, on common, £250 yearly. Whereas they promise networking and profession progress, not all memberships present sufficient worth to justify the prices.
- Trying good: Jobs anticipating a cultured look can include hefty (though probably non-compulsory) bills. Common haircuts, manicures, {and professional} clothes can price round £500 yearly. Trying sharp isn’t low cost!
What are you able to do?
To handle these hidden prices, begin by taking a look at all job-related bills. This gives you a transparent image of how a lot your job is costing you.
Are you able to get a refund for any journey, workplace provides, or skilled growth?
Some employers provide a season ticket mortgage, which you pay again over a yr to cut back the associated fee. If you happen to want sure issues for work, like having to clean your uniforms or needing to be a member of knowledgeable physique, you possibly can declare tax aid.
